[2] In 2012, he graduated in the field of Communication studies and 2 years later, he received a master's degree in International Relations and Diplomacy at the Faculty of Political Science in Sarajevo.
Besides his affinity for music, he was professionally involved in politics where he served as a member of the Board of directors of the Federal Pension and Disability Insurance Institute in Sarajevo (2014-2018).

At the beginning of 2019, he signed an exclusive publishing contract with Tempo Digital record label, owned by Almir Ajanović, an established producer and musician from Sarajevo.
Along with Goran, many notable musicians, singers and producers from Bosnia and Herzegovina such as Almir Ajanović, Damir Bečić, Tarik Mulaomerović, Adnan Pacoli and Peđa Hart worked on it.
Auto-Tune Pop rap and melodic singing predominate, with admixtures of EDM, Dance and trap rhythms, which are often mixed with Reggaeton, Dancehall and Balkan ethno sounds.
In his songs, he combines several world genres such as Pop, Hip Hop, Rap, EDM, Trap, Dance, Reggaeton, Dancehall and specific Balkan's ethno style.
